How exactly does a drone survey work?

Drones are also referred to as unmanned aerial vehicles (UAVs).

When employed for conducting a survey, they record aerial data utilizing a LiDAR scanning device and data record detectors that happen to be attached for the drone. The scanning device produces a laser pulse which accumulates ground specifications by working out your time it requires for that beam of light going to the ground and reflect again.

Several images are considered from the land below so that you can bit together a full photo of the space. This maps natural and physical functions, curves and elevations on the site.

Using the captured data, a number of deliverables might be made. Including both 2D and 3D formats, including land survey sketches and digital terrain models. They are useful for offering an exact digital reflection of existing structure and topography.

Crucially, all drone surveys has to be carried out by a person or company which happens to be registered through the Civil Aviation Authority (CAA). Though drones take flight at a reduce altitude than manned aircraft, users must still comply with UK aviation regulations.

Exactly what can drone surveying be applied for?

You can find a number of projects that aerial drone surveys can be used for, such as:

Topographic surveys

Well suited for gathering data about natural and man-manufactured sites, as well as both small and big land locations, a drone survey is well-fitted to topographic surveys.

Roof inspections

A drone survey allows fast access to challenging-to-reach rooves for inspection, consequently taking away the necessity for time-intensive work and expensive equipment.

Construction inspections

For successful monitoring in the on-site advancement of your construction project, a drone survey bring a quick way of getting as-created data.

Property condition surveys

A drone survey can seize photogrammetry to create high-quality orthomosaics which make it possible for digital visualisation of small and not reachable areas.

Infra-red energy imaging surveys

Well suited for assisting to make certain BREEAM (Building Research Establishment Enviromentally friendly Assessment Method) conformity, drone surveys can be used infrared energy detection and thermal imaging on the building or construction site.

Do you know the benefits of using a drone for any survey?

Drone surveys have numerous benefits which make them a very important survey solution for many projects. Some examples are:

Quicker

Employing a drone for any land survey is a fast and easy way to obtain data. As a result the surveying procedure much more time efficient than other strategies such as terrestrial surveys.

Whereas a conventional topographic survey might involve two surveyors investing a week on site to collect the data, a drone survey can achieve the exact same produces a couple of hours, even on bigger sites.

Also, using the data collected quicker, plans and models can be created and supplied sooner, ensuing in the fast turnaround time that lots of clients look for.

Cost-effective

Being a drone survey is much easier and considerably less labour rigorous than other surveying strategies, it is far more economical.

The time where a drone survey could be executed ensures that much less field time as well as manpower is needed. This slices the labor expenses therefore the identical survey data may be collected and provided at a reduced price general.

Less hazardous Accessibility

With utilization of a drone, formerly hard to get at or dangerous places might be more easily and safely arrived at.

While there are a few restrictions, including use within densely stuffed places or during adverse weather problems, drone surveys can operate in most locations. Consequently harsh surfaces and unreachable places might be captured relatively very easily.
